Bare ActsThe ANDHRA PRADESH PROHIBITION OF COW SLAUGHTER AND ANIMAL PRESERVATION ACT, 1977.

Section 3

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

Definitions- In this Act unless the context otherwise requires,- (i) ‘animal’ means bull, bullock, buffaloe, male or female, or calf, whether male or female, of a she-buffaloe; (ii) ‘competent authority’ means a person or a body of persons appointed under section 4 to perform the functions of a competent authority under this Act; (iii) ‘cow’ includes a heifer, or a calf, whether male or female, of a cow; (iv)’ Government’ means the State Government; (v) ‘notification’ means a notification published in the Andhra Pradesh Gazette and the word ‘notified’ shall be construed accordingly; (vi) ‘Prescribed’ means prescribed by rules made under this Act.
